Ryanair chief sells €39m shares

Ryanair chief executive Michael O’Leary pocketed around €39m today after selling part of his stake in the budget airline.

Mr O’Leary gave no reason for his decision to sell six million shares, reducing his holding by 0.8% of the company to 4.5%. It still leaves him the firm’s biggest individual investor.
